What is an Explosion-proof Electric V-Ball Valve?

An Explosion-proof Electric V-Ball Valve is a specialized valve equipped with electric actuators, designed for use in environments where explosive atmospheres may occur. The “V-Ball” refers to the unique V-shaped ball inside the valve body, which provides a precise and efficient way of controlling the flow of fluids. The electric actuator allows for remote or automatic operation, making it ideal for systems that require automated control. The explosion-proof design of these valves ensures that they can withstand high-pressure, high-temperature conditions without causing sparks or igniting the surrounding atmosphere. This makes them a reliable solution for industries such as chemical processing, oil and gas, pharmaceuticals, and petrochemicals, where volatile substances are commonly handled.
